From 0868bc13c29005b110fcfbdcd8e0ebc65ded2467 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Daniel=20Cort=C3=A9s?= Date: Tue, 7 May 2019 20:02:08 -0400 Subject: [PATCH] Creada vista de ver autor Esta sin usar en ninguna parte pero esta creada --- .../autor/AutorViewController.java | 23 +++++ .../views/autor/AutorViewPanel.form | 93 +++++++++++++++++++ .../views/autor/AutorViewPanel.java | 28 ++++++ 3 files changed, 144 insertions(+) create mode 100644 src/main/java/xyz/danielcortes/controllers/autor/AutorViewController.java create mode 100644 src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.form create mode 100644 src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.java diff --git a/src/main/java/xyz/danielcortes/controllers/autor/AutorViewController.java b/src/main/java/xyz/danielcortes/controllers/autor/AutorViewController.java new file mode 100644 index 0000000..9c21df3 --- /dev/null +++ b/src/main/java/xyz/danielcortes/controllers/autor/AutorViewController.java @@ -0,0 +1,23 @@ +package xyz.danielcortes.controllers.autor; + +import xyz.danielcortes.models.Autor; +import xyz.danielcortes.views.autor.AutorViewPanel; + +public class AutorViewController { + + private AutorViewPanel view; + private Autor autor; + + public AutorViewController(AutorViewPanel view, Autor autor){ + this.view = view; + this.autor = autor; + this.fillAutor(); + } + + private void fillAutor() { + this.view.getNombreField().setText(this.autor.getNombre()); + this.view.getApellidoPaternoField().setText(this.autor.getApellidoPaterno()); + this.view.getApellidoMaternoField().setText(this.autor.getApellidoMaterno()); + } + +} diff --git a/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.form b/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.form new file mode 100644 index 0000000..3b50f54 --- /dev/null +++ b/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.form @@ -0,0 +1,93 @@ + +
+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+ +
diff --git a/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.java b/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.java new file mode 100644 index 0000000..5557d80 --- /dev/null +++ b/src/main/java/xyz/danielcortes/views/autor/AutorViewPanel.java @@ -0,0 +1,28 @@ +package xyz.danielcortes.views.autor; + +import javax.swing.JButton; +import javax.swing.JTextField; + +public class AutorViewPanel { + + private JTextField nombreField; + private JTextField apellidoPaternoField; + private JTextField apellidoMaternoField; + private JButton volverButton; + + public JTextField getNombreField() { + return nombreField; + } + + public JTextField getApellidoPaternoField() { + return apellidoPaternoField; + } + + public JTextField getApellidoMaternoField() { + return apellidoMaternoField; + } + + public JButton getVolverButton() { + return volverButton; + } +}